How To Identify The Difference Between An Evaporator Coil And A Condenser Coil

To identify the difference between an evaporator coil and a condenser coil, it is important to understand the basic principles of air conditioning. An evaporator coil is a key component of any air conditioner, as it absorbs heat from inside the home and passes it outside.

A condenser coil is located outside and expels the heat collected by the evaporator coil from inside the home. The evaporator coil is often referred to as an "indoor coil" because it is typically located inside the air handler unit of a split-system air conditioner.

The condenser coil, on the other hand, is considered an "outdoor coil" because it sits outside in direct contact with the environment. The two coils are designed to work in tandem; while one removes heat from within a space, the other releases this heat into the outside atmosphere.

Understanding The Pros And Cons Of Different Types Of Refrigerant Used In Acs

The type of refrigerant used in an air conditioning unit is a key factor in the cost of replacing an evaporator coil. Different types of refrigerants have varied levels of efficiency, and the selection can have a significant impact on the overall cost of replacement.

R-22, commonly known as Freon, is widely used due to its low cost and wide availability. However, it has recently been phased out by the EPA due to its ozone depleting properties and has been replaced with R-410A.

While R-410A is more efficient than R-22 and produces less greenhouse gas emissions, it also costs significantly more than its predecessor. Additionally, newer refrigerants such as R-32 have become increasingly popular due to their high energy efficiency ratings.

How Much Does It Cost To Replace A Coil In An Ac?

When it comes to replacing an evaporator coil in an AC unit, the cost can vary greatly. Factors such as the type of coil and size of the unit, as well as labor costs, all have an effect on the total cost.

On average, a new evaporator coil can range anywhere from $700-$2,000 depending on the complexity of the installation and part quality. The labor required for installation can also add significantly to the total cost.

Professional HVAC technicians typically charge between $100-$200 per hour for labor alone. In addition to these costs, there may be other repair or maintenance costs associated with replacing your AC’s evaporator coil such as ductwork repairs or additional parts needed for installation that could add up quickly.

How Do I Know If My Ac Coil Is Bad?

When it comes to knowing if your AC evaporator coil is bad, it’s important to understand the signs and symptoms that may indicate an issue.

Common signs that your coil needs to be replaced include impaired cooling, musty odors, warm air blowing from the vents, and loud or strange noises coming from the unit.

If you are experiencing any of these signs in combination with a rise in energy bills or frequent repairs, then it’s likely time to replace your AC evaporator coil.

To ensure you have the right replacement for your system, make sure you know the type of refrigerant used in your unit and its tonnage capacity before purchasing a new coil.
